Special episode: Look back at the 2000 Final Four run with Dick Bennett and members of the team 21.02.2019

Nearly two decades ago, the Wisconsin Badgers men's basketball team made an improbable run to the Final Four and set the table for a cycle of success that featured 19 consecutive appearances in the NCAA Tournament for a program that was seldom a qualifier for the Big Dance beforehand.
